The Foundational Role of Whole Foods
At the core of healthy eating is the principle of prioritizing whole, unprocessed foods. This means a diet rich in fruits, vegetables, legumes, whole grains, and lean proteins, and low in added sugars, unhealthy fats, and excessive sodium. Scientific evidence strongly supports the benefits of such a diet, linking it to a lower risk of chronic diseases like heart disease, diabetes, and certain cancers. Processed foods, on the other hand, have been linked to a higher risk of health issues and weight gain, often containing 'empty calories' that offer little nutritional value. By choosing foods as close to their natural state as possible, you provide your body with the fundamental building blocks—macronutrients and micronutrients—it needs to function optimally.
The Complexity of Individual Needs
One of the most important conclusions about nutrition is that there is no single 'perfect' diet for everyone. Individual needs are highly variable and depend on a range of factors, including age, gender, activity level, health status, and genetics. What works for a sedentary adult may not be suitable for an elite athlete, and a pregnant woman has different nutritional requirements than a child. Furthermore, advancements in 'omics' technologies are revealing how individual genetic makeup and gut microbiome composition can influence responses to specific foods. This concept of 'bio-individuality' highlights why a rigid, one-size-fits-all diet is often unsuccessful in the long run. Focusing on foundational principles and then tailoring them to personal needs is a more sustainable strategy.
The Dangers of Fad and Crash Diets
Many popular diets promise rapid results through severe calorie restriction or the elimination of entire food groups. However, crash diets have significant long-term risks, including:
- Slowed Metabolism: The body adapts to low calorie intake by conserving energy, which can lead to a permanently lower metabolic rate, making weight management more difficult in the future.
- Muscle Loss: Extreme diets often lack sufficient protein, causing the body to break down muscle tissue for energy, further slowing metabolism.
- Nutrient Deficiencies: Restrictive eating can deprive the body of essential vitamins and minerals, leading to health problems like fatigue, hair loss, and weakened immunity.
- Weight Cycling: The deprivation-binge cycle, or 'yo-yo dieting,' is common and can be detrimental to both physical and mental health.
- Disordered Eating: Extreme dieting can trigger or reinforce unhealthy eating patterns and a toxic relationship with food.

The Power of Nutrients and Balanced Intake
Proper nutrition involves achieving a balance of macronutrients (carbohydrates, proteins, and fats) and ensuring adequate intake of micronutrients (vitamins and minerals). Carbohydrates are the body's primary energy source, while proteins are crucial for tissue repair and growth. Healthy fats are essential for hormone production, cell growth, and nutrient absorption. A key conclusion is that moderation and balance are more effective than elimination. For example, replacing saturated fats with unsaturated fats can reduce the risk of heart disease. Likewise, opting for whole grains over refined carbohydrates provides more fiber and sustained energy.
The Broader Context of Health and Well-being
Diet and nutrition don't exist in a vacuum. A person's overall health is a complex interplay of genetic, environmental, and behavioral factors. Adequate nutrition provides the foundation, but it is supported by other healthy lifestyle choices such as regular physical activity, sufficient hydration, and managing stress. Nutrition can boost athletic performance, improve cognitive function, and enhance overall quality of life. Therefore, the most powerful conclusion is that nutrition is a long-term investment in your well-being, not a short-term fix. It requires sustained effort and a focus on nutrient density over caloric restriction.
